Class: RightAws::S3Interface::S3HttpResponseParser
- Inherits:
-
Object
- Object
- RightAws::S3Interface::S3HttpResponseParser
- Defined in:
- lib/s3/right_s3_interface.rb
Overview
PARSERS: Non XML
Direct Known Subclasses
S3HttpResponseBodyParser, S3HttpResponseHeadParser, S3TrueParser
Instance Attribute Summary collapse
-
#result ⇒ Object
readonly
:nodoc:.
Instance Method Summary collapse
Instance Attribute Details
#result ⇒ Object (readonly)
:nodoc:
826 827 828 |
# File 'lib/s3/right_s3_interface.rb', line 826 def result @result end |
Instance Method Details
#headers_to_string(headers) ⇒ Object
830 831 832 833 834 835 836 837 |
# File 'lib/s3/right_s3_interface.rb', line 830 def headers_to_string(headers) result = {} headers.each do |key, value| value = value.to_s if value.is_a?(Array) && value.size<2 result[key] = value end result end |
#parse(response) ⇒ Object
827 828 829 |
# File 'lib/s3/right_s3_interface.rb', line 827 def parse(response) @result = response end |